Whirlpool Refrigerator Repair

A functioning refrigerator is essential for a healthy home. We specialize in Whirlpool refrigerator repair in Somerville, servicing side-by-side, French door, top freezer, and bottom freezer models. A common issue we address is a refrigerator that is not cooling properly. This can often be traced to dirty condenser coils, a failed start relay, or a malfunction in the defrost system. We are also well versed in repairing Whirlpool’s specific Jazz control boards, which manage the cooling cycles in many models.

Ice maker problems are another frequent request. If your ice maker is not producing ice or is leaking water, we can troubleshoot the modular ice maker assembly, the water inlet valve, and the optic sensor boards. We also resolve issues with water dispensers that have stopped working or are dripping. Additionally, we fix noisy refrigerators caused by worn evaporator fan motors or rattling compressor mounts. Whirlpool Washing Machine Repair

Whirlpool washing machines are known for their durability, but they work hard and can develop issues. We provide expert Whirlpool washer repair for traditional direct drive models, Cabrio top loaders, and Duet front loaders. One of the most common problems we solve is a washer that will not spin or drain. On top loaders, this is often caused by a broken lid switch or a worn drive coupler. On front loaders, it usually points to a clogged drain pump filter or a central control unit failure.

We also address agitation issues. If your clothes are not coming out clean, the agitator dogs (small plastic cams) may be worn out, preventing the top of the agitator from moving. For Cabrio models that are making loud roaring noises, we often replace the tub bearings and drive shaft. We also fix leaks that originate from the tub seal, drain hose, or water inlet valves. We troubleshoot error codes related to load sensing and motor speed to ensure your washer operates smoothly.

Whirlpool Dryer Repair

A broken dryer can turn laundry day into a logistical nightmare. Our Whirlpool dryer repair services cover both gas and electric units. The most frequent issue is a dryer that runs but does not heat. In electric models, this is typically due to a broken heating element or a blown thermal cutoff fuse. In gas models, we often replace weak igniters or faulty gas valve coils. We carry the specific heating components used in Whirlpool dryers to expedite the repair process.

We also resolve airflow issues. If your dryer is taking multiple cycles to dry clothes, it likely has a restricted vent or a clogged blower wheel. We clean the internal air ducts of the dryer to improve performance and reduce fire risks. Other common repairs include replacing squeaky drum support rollers, worn idler pulleys, and broken drive belts. We also fix starting issues caused by defective door switches or push-to-start buttons.

Whirlpool Dishwasher Repair

Whirlpool dishwashers are designed to make cleanup easy. When they fail, we offer comprehensive Whirlpool dishwasher service. If your dishes are not getting clean, we inspect the pump and motor assembly and the TotalCoverage spray arm for blockages. We also check the diverter motor, which directs water to the different spray arms. If the unit is not draining, we examine the check valve and the drain pump for debris like glass or food particles.

Leaks are another major concern. We replace worn door gaskets and tighten loose hose connections to prevent water damage to your kitchen floor. We also troubleshoot electronic issues, such as control panels that become unresponsive or display flashing lights. Whether it is a bad user interface board or a thermal fuse that has blown, we have the skills to get your dishwasher running again.

Whirlpool Oven, Range, and Cooktop Repair

We provide Whirlpool oven repair and range service for gas and electric models, including the Gold and varying AccuBake series. If your oven is not heating to the correct temperature, we can calibrate the control board or replace the temperature sensor. For electric ovens that will not bake or broil, we replace burnt out heating elements. For gas ovens, we frequently replace igniters that have become too weak to open the safety gas valve.

On the cooktop, we fix burners that will not light or will not stay lit. This often involves cleaning the burner ports or replacing the spark module. We also service glass ceramic cooktops, replacing faulty infinite switches that cause elements to stay on high or not turn on at all. We address issues with the self cleaning cycle, such as doors that lock permanently or thermal fuses that trip due to excessive heat.

Understanding Common Whirlpool Appliance Error Codes

Whirlpool appliances use digital error codes to communicate specific failures. While these codes are helpful indicators, they require professional interpretation to identify the exact root cause.

  • Washer F1 or E2: These codes on a Duet or Cabrio washer often indicate a motor control error. It means the main control board is not receiving the correct signals from the motor, which could be a wiring issue or a failed motor control board.
  • Dishwasher F8 or E1: This typically signifies a water flow issue. The dishwasher is not filling fast enough, or the drain is taking too long. It directs us to check the water inlet valve or the drain hose.
  • Oven F2 or F3: F2 usually relates to a keypad failure or a stuck key. F3 indicates an open or shorted oven temperature sensor. These codes tell us which circuit to test first.
  • Dryer F01: This code usually points to a main electronic control board failure. It means the primary computer of the dryer has detected an internal error and cannot operate the machine.

  • Why is my Whirlpool refrigerator not cooling?
    If your Whirlpool refrigerator is running but not cooling, the most common culprit is dirty condenser coils. These coils release heat from the refrigerant; if they are clogged with dust, the compressor overheats and shuts off prematurely. Another common issue is a failure of the evaporator fan motor in the freezer. If this fan stops, cold air cannot circulate to the fresh food section. In some cases, the start relay on the compressor may have failed, preventing the compressor from starting. We also check the defrost timer or control board, as a stuck defrost cycle will silence the cooling system.
  • How to reset a Whirlpool Cabrio washer that won’t spin?
    Whirlpool Cabrio washers are sensitive to load imbalance and control glitches. Sometimes a “reset” can be performed by unplugging the unit for a minute and then plugging it back in to clear the memory. However, if the washer consistently refuses to spin, it is rarely a software glitch. It is more likely a mechanical issue. The hub assembly under the wash plate often strips out, or the lid lock mechanism fails. The washer must verify the lid is locked before it will spin at high speeds. If the lock sensor is bad, the spin cycle will be aborted.
  • Why is my Whirlpool dishwasher not cleaning dishes?
    Poor cleaning performance is usually due to a lack of water pressure or a blockage. Check the filter at the bottom of the tub to ensure it is not clogged with food debris. Also, inspect the holes in the spray arms. If they are blocked by seeds or mineral deposits, the water spray will be weak. We also check the water inlet valve. If the valve is restricted, the dishwasher may not fill with enough water to pump effectively. Using the correct detergent and rinse aid is also critical for optimal results in modern machines.
  • My Whirlpool dryer is running but not heating, what is wrong?
    For electric Whirlpool dryers, this is almost always a heating element failure. The element is a coil of wire that gets hot; over time, it breaks. We can test this for continuity with a multimeter. It could also be a blown thermal cutoff fuse, which is a safety device located on the heater housing. For gas dryers, the problem is usually the igniter. If the igniter does not get hot enough to glow white hot, the flame sensor will not allow the gas valve to open. We replace these components to restore heat.
  • Why is my Whirlpool Duet washer shaking violently?
    A front load washer like the Duet spins at very high speeds. If it shakes violently, first check that the machine is perfectly level. If it is level, the issue is internal. The shock absorbers, which connect the outer tub to the base frame, may be worn out. If they lose their resistance, the tub will bounce uncontrollably. Another possibility is a broken spider arm assembly on the back of the drum, which causes the drum to wobble off center. This is a significant repair that requires disassembly of the tub.
  • Whirlpool oven not heating to correct temperature?
    If your oven temperature seems off, the temperature sensor may have drifted out of calibration. We can test the resistance of the sensor to see if it matches the manufacturer’s specifications. If the sensor is good, the issue may be with the control board itself or a weak igniter in a gas oven. A weak igniter may take too long to light the burner, causing the oven to cycle on and off too slowly, resulting in a lower average temperature.
  • How to fix a leaking Whirlpool dishwasher?
    Leaks often occur at the door seal. Check the black rubber gasket around the door for rips or food particles that might prevent a good seal. Another common leak source is the pump motor shaft seal underneath the unit. If you see water dripping from the center of the machine, the pump assembly likely needs to be replaced. Leaks can also come from the water inlet valve if it is cracked or if the hose connection is loose. We trace the water path to find the source.
  • Why is my Whirlpool ice maker not making ice?
    The ice maker requires a temperature of roughly 0 to 10 degrees Fahrenheit to trigger a harvest cycle. If your freezer is not cold enough, the ice maker will sit idle. If the temperature is correct, the issue could be the water inlet valve not opening to fill the mold, or the ice maker module itself having a broken gear or motor. On some Whirlpool models, an optic sensor board on the freezer wall detects the ice level; if this board fails, the system thinks the bin is full and stops production.
